site stats

Optimal binary search trees problems

WebSolve practice problems for Binary Search Tree to test your programming skills. Also go through detailed tutorials to improve your understanding to the topic. page 1 ... All Tracks Data Structures Trees Binary Search Tree . Data Structures. Topics: Binary Search Tree. Arrays 1-D; Multi-dimensional; Stacks Basics of Stacks ... WebSolve practice problems for Binary Search Tree to test your programming skills. Also go through detailed tutorials to improve your understanding to the topic. page 1 ... All …

Binary Search Tree - GeeksforGeeks

WebIn optimal binary search trees, not all the elements are stored in the leaves, and a successful search may end up in an internal node. So if Huffman trees and optimal BSTs can both … http://cslibrary.stanford.edu/110/BinaryTrees.html early signs of myeloma cancer https://a1fadesbarbershop.com

Optimal binary search tree Practice GeeksforGeeks

WebFeb 18, 2024 · Optimal Binary Search Tree. I could'nt find the Optimal Binary Search Tree, on leetcode. But learning from this problem made me do OBST. Given a sorted array keys … WebOptimal Binary Search Trees A binary search tree is a special kind of binary tree in which the nodes are arranged in such a way that the smaller values fall in the left subnode, and … WebApr 13, 2024 · I have written this Binary Search Algorithm. It is working fine. But when I assign a target value of 6, or 100 it responds back as "Not found in Array"? ... Binary Search Algorithm Having Problems. Ask Question Asked today. Modified today. Viewed 6 times 0 I have written this Binary Search Algorithm. ... Ukkonen's suffix tree algorithm in plain ... csu factbook 2022

Binary Search Tree Practice Problems Data Structures page 1 ...

Category:Today: Optimal Binary Search

Tags:Optimal binary search trees problems

Optimal binary search trees problems

Today: Optimal Binary Search

WebTo construct a binary search tree, we have to determine if the key already exists in the BST or not for each given key. The cost of finding a BST key is equal to the level of the key (if present in the BST). Output: The optimal cost of constructing BST is 95. 25 lookups of the key 0 will cost 1 each. 20 lookups of the key 2 will cost 2 each. WebDefinition (Optimal Binary Search Tree (OBST) Problem) The optimal binary search tree (OBST) problem is given an ordered set of keys and a probability function : where is the set of all BSTs on , and is the depth of the key in the tree (the root has depth 1). Brute Force

Optimal binary search trees problems

Did you know?

WebThe non-balancing binary tree which has keys inserted into it in sorted order is not optimal, because the keys will not distribute evenly. Instead, you will get a linked list, because all of … WebDec 14, 2012 · An Optimal Binary Search Tree (OBST), also known as a Weighted Binary Search Tree, is a binary search tree that minimizes the expected search cost. In a binary search tree, the search cost is the number of comparisons required to search for a given … Given the dimension of a sequence of matrices in an array arr[], where the dimensi… Complexity Analysis: Time Complexity: O(sum*n), where sum is the ‘target sum’ a… So Dynamic Programming is not useful when there are no common (overlapping) … Amount of water in jth glass of ith row is: 0.500000. Time Complexity: O(i*(i+1)/2) …

WebDynamic Programming Optimal Binary Search Trees Section 3.5 . Some redefinitions of BST • The text, “Foundations of Algorithms” defines the level, height and depth of a tree a little differently than Carrano/Prichard • The depth of a node is the number of edges in the path from the root to the node – This is also the level of the node WebApply the dynamic programming approach to the following data and construct optimal binary search trees. Draw the resulting tree. Note: İhtimal = Possibility. Show transcribed image text. Expert Answer. Who are the experts? Experts are tested by Chegg as specialists in their subject area. We reviewed their content and use your feedback to keep ...

WebNov 25, 2024 · An exhaustive search for optimal binary search tree leads to huge amount of time. The goal is to construct a tree which minimizes the total search cost. Such tree is … WebSTAPLES SA 456 Final Examination, Fall-2024-v1 Question 4 [Binary Search Tree: 5 marks]: The drawing below shows the current state of a binary search tree. 25 a) List out the visited nodes with following tree traversal methods i. Pre-order: ii. In-order: iii. Post-order: b) Delete 40 from the above binary search tree. Draw the binary search t...

WebA Binary Search Tree (BST) is a tree where the key values are stored in the internal nodes. The external nodes are null nodes. The keys are ordered lexicographically, i.e. for each internal node all the keys in the left sub-tree are less than the keys in the node, and all the keys in the right sub-tree are greater.

Webas our optimal binary search tree. Further we can use divide and conquer strategy to solve our problem. Note that if we have an optimal binary tree then at any node of that tree, it … csu fact book 2022WebApr 11, 2024 · AVL Tree Implementation in Python: This repository provides a comprehensive implementation of an AVL tree (balanced binary search tree) with Node … early signs of omicronWeb224 10K views 1 year ago Design and Analysis of Algorithms This video is to solve the Optimal Binary Search Tree problem For CSE/IT Students - Unit 1 (Dynamic Programming … csu fact bookWebOptimal binary search tree Practice GeeksforGeeks Given a sorted array keys[0.. n-1] of search keys and an array freq[0.. n-1] of frequency counts, where freq[i] is the number of … early signs of opioid withdrawalWeb2 days ago · Inspired by [28], [29] proposed optimal sparse decision trees (OSDT) that also use branch-and-bound search, but are limited to binary classification. Analytic bounds are used to prune the search space while the number of leaves is constrained using a regularised loss function that balances accuracy and the number of leaves. early signs of neurogenic shockWebThe quality of a search tree is the sum of the frequencies of the words under each node: @=sum, q (T)=sum of frequencies of sides below the top edge of T in the triangulation. To … early signs of myasthenia gravis relapseWebAug 25, 2024 · In Binary Search Tree (BST)we know that for each node in the tree, left-sub tree of that particular node contains lesser value than the parent node and similarly for right-sub tree that it contains higher value than the parent node.. Basically, we know the key values of the each node, but let say we also know the frequencies of each node in the … early signs of oral cancer pictures